Jim Jermanok has spoken to dozens of audiences worldwide at colleges and universities, film festivals, theaters, and media/arts organizations on the 25 years of wisdom he's acquired about succeeding in the world of entertainment. For the first decade of his career, Jim was employed as an ICM (International Creative Management) Agent where he represented Alan Arkin, John Guare, Helen Hayes, Arthur Miller, Shirley MacLaine, Dudley Moore, Henry Winkler and General H. Norman Schwarzkopf, among others. There, he was privy to understanding how actors, writers, directors, and producers succeeded in the entertainment industry.  What they have in common in contrast to the majority of creative folks who fail to make a living in their chosen creative field.

Jim Jermanok did exactly what his clients advised and for the past 16 years he has had the good fortune to work as an award-winning writer, director and producer in independent film, theater, television and new media.  In 2003, a full-length feature romantic comedy he wrote and produced, "PASSIONADA," was released by The Samuel Goldwyn Company domestically and by Columbia Tri-Star internationally in over 150 countries.  He was very fortunate to receive high praise from a number of prominent film critics, including "Two Thumbs Up!" from Ebert and Roper.  In 2008, Jim produced "EM," an intense romantic drama by the gifted writer-director, Tony Barbieri ("The Magic of Marciano").  "EM" had it world premiere in June 2008 at the Seattle Intl. Film Festival, where it won the Grand Jury Prize for Best Film from among the more than 200 entries.  It had a worldwide release late last year by Vanguard Cinema and SnagFilms.
